Volunteer Opportunities
Thank you for viewing the volunteer opportunities available through the Westonka Horticultural Society. It is the volunteer who provides the ground work to build the Westonka Horticultural Society into a viable community organization. We appreciate your consideration to offer your time and talent.
Volunteers need not be gardeners, just a passion to help. Many of these positions can be a team effort. If you have a friend you would like to work with or if you wish to be matched with another volunteer for a project, please contact us. Most volunteer positions are short-term with a few long-term commitments.
Volunteer Opportunities Currently Available
Community Events
Represent the Westonka Horticultural Society at community events. Share WHS information at vendor tables, network with other gardeners or business professionals. No formal training required, only a friendly smile! Select one or all. All supplies for events are provided. Some of these events include but are not limited to:
